## Key Features
|
||||
|
||||
### 1. Security-First Design
|
||||
- **No hardcoded secrets** - All credentials stored in 1Password
|
||||
- **1Password integration** - Secrets injected at runtime via `op inject`
|
||||
- **Template-based configuration** - `.template` files in git, resolved configs excluded
|
||||
- **Network isolation** - Internal services not exposed to internet
|
||||
|
||||
### 2. Multi-Layer Network Security
|
||||
|
||||
| Service | Exposure | Access Method |
|
||||
|---------|----------|---------------|
|
||||
| Gitea Web | Public | HTTPS via Caddy (git.terraphim.cloud) |
|
||||
| Gitea SSH | Public | Port 222 direct |
|
||||
| Prometheus | Tailscale only | http://100.106.66.7:9000 |
|
||||
| S3 API | Tailscale only | http://100.106.66.7:8333 |
|
||||
| PostgreSQL | Internal only | Docker network |
|
||||
| SeaweedFS | Internal only | Docker network |
|
||||
|
||||
### 3. Technology Stack
|
||||
- **Gitea 1.22.6** - Git hosting with Actions support
|
||||
- **PostgreSQL 15** - Database
|
||||
- **SeaweedFS** - Distributed S3-compatible object storage
|
||||
- **Prometheus** - Metrics and monitoring
|
||||
- **Caddy** - Reverse proxy with automatic HTTPS
|
||||
- **1Password CLI** - Secrets management
|
||||
- **Tailscale** - VPN for internal services
|

## Deployment Process
|
||||
|
||||
### Prerequisites
|
||||
- SSH access to bigbox
|
||||
- 1Password service account configured (`~/op_zesticai_non_prod.sh`)
|
||||
- Caddy already running on bigbox
|
||||
- Docker and Docker Compose installed
|
||||
|
||||
### Step 1: Create 1Password Vault Items
|
||||
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
eval $(op signin)
|
||||
|
||||
# Create PostgreSQL credentials
|
||||
op item create \
|
||||
--vault="TerraphimPlatform" \
|
||||
--category=login \
|
||||
--title="gitea-postgres" \
|
||||
--generate-password=20,letters,digits \
|
||||
username=gitea
|
||||
|
||||
# Create S3 credentials
|
||||
op item create \
|
||||
--vault="TerraphimPlatform" \
|
||||
--category=custom \
|
||||
--title="gitea-s3" \
|
||||
access-key="$(openssl rand -hex 20)" \
|
||||
secret-key="$(openssl rand -hex 40)"
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Step 2: Template Configuration Files
|
||||
|
||||
Create `.template` files with 1Password references:
|
||||
|
||||
**docker-compose.yml.template:**
|
||||
```yaml
|
||||
version: "3"
|
||||
|
||||
services:
|
||||
server:
|
||||
image: gitea/gitea:1.22.6
|
||||
environment:
|
||||
- GITEA__database__PASSWD=op://TerraphimPlatform/gitea-postgres/password
|
||||
- GITEA__storage__MINIO_ACCESS_KEY_ID=op://TerraphimPlatform/gitea-s3/access-key
|
||||
- GITEA__storage__MINIO_SECRET_ACCESS_KEY=op://TerraphimPlatform/gitea-s3/secret-key
|
||||
# ... other config
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
**s3_config.json.template:**
|
||||
```json
|
||||
{
|
||||
"identities": [{
|
||||
"name": "gitea",
|
||||
"credentials": [{
|
||||
"accessKey": "op://TerraphimPlatform/gitea-s3/access-key",
|
||||
"secretKey": "op://TerraphimPlatform/gitea-s3/secret-key"
|
||||
}]
|
||||
}]
|
||||
}
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Step 3: Inject Secrets and Deploy
|
||||
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Source 1Password credentials
|
||||
source ~/op_zesticai_non_prod.sh
|
||||
|
||||
# Inject secrets into configuration files
|
||||
op inject --in-file docker-compose.yml.template --out-file docker-compose.yml
|
||||
op inject --in-file s3_config.json.template --out-file s3_config.json
|
||||
|
||||
# Start services
|
||||
docker compose up -d
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Step 4: Configure Caddy
|
||||
|
||||
Add Gitea route to existing Caddy instance:
|
||||
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Add route via Caddy Admin API
|
||||
curl -X POST http://localhost:2019/config/apps/http/servers/srv0/routes \
|
||||
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
|
||||
-d '{
|
||||
"@id": "gitea_route",
|
||||
"match": [{"host": ["git.terraphim.cloud"]}],
|
||||
"handle": [{
|
||||
"handler": "subroute",
|
||||
"routes": [{
|
||||
"handle": [{
|
||||
"handler": "reverse_proxy",
|
||||
"upstreams": [{"dial": "localhost:3000"}]
|
||||
}]
|
||||
}]
|
||||
}],
|
||||
"terminal": true
|
||||
}'
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
**Important:** Route order matters! Add specific routes before wildcard routes.
|

## Network Configuration Details
|
||||
|
||||
### Port Bindings
|
||||
|
||||
**Gitea (Public):**
|
||||
- `127.0.0.1:3000:3000` - HTTP via Caddy
|
||||
- `0.0.0.0:222:22` - SSH direct access
|
||||
|
||||
**Prometheus (Tailscale only):**
|
||||
- `100.106.66.7:9000:9090` - Only accessible via Tailscale
|
||||
|
||||
**S3 API (Tailscale only):**
|
||||
- `100.106.66.7:8333:8333` - Only accessible via Tailscale
|
||||
- `100.106.66.7:9327:9327` - Prometheus metrics
|
||||
|
||||
### Docker Compose Network Isolation
|
||||
|
||||
```yaml
|
||||
networks:
|
||||
gitea:
|
||||
external: false # Internal Docker network only
|
||||
|
||||
services:
|
||||
db:
|
||||
networks:
|
||||
- gitea # No external ports
|
||||
|
||||
master:
|
||||
# No ports exposed - internal only
|
||||
|
||||
volume:
|
||||
# No ports exposed - internal only
|
||||
|
||||
filer:
|
||||
# No ports exposed - internal only
|
||||
```

## Troubleshooting
|
||||
|
||||
### Permission Denied Errors
|
||||
If Gitea shows permission errors:
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
sudo chown -R 1000:1000 gitea/
|
||||
sudo chmod -R 755 gitea/
|
||||
docker compose restart server
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Route Not Working
|
||||
Check Caddy route order:
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
curl -s http://localhost:2019/config/apps/http/servers/srv0/routes | \
|
||||
jq '.[] | select(.match[0].host[0] | contains("terraphim")) | .match[0].host[0]'
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
Specific routes must come before wildcard routes.
|
||||
|
||||
### 1Password Authentication
|
||||
Verify service account:
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
source ~/op_zesticai_non_prod.sh
|
||||
op vault list
|
||||
```

## Maintenance
|
||||
|
||||
### Backup
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Backup data directories
|
||||
rsync -avz bigbox:~/gitea-stack/gitea ./backup/
|
||||
rsync -avz bigbox:~/gitea-stack/postgres ./backup/
|
||||
rsync -avz bigbox:~/gitea-stack/seaweedfs ./backup/
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Update Images
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
cd ~/gitea-stack
|
||||
docker compose pull
|
||||
docker compose up -d
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Rotate Secrets
|
||||
1. Update in 1Password vault
|
||||
2. Re-run deployment:
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
source ~/op_zesticai_non_prod.sh
|
||||
op inject --in-file docker-compose.yml.template --out-file docker-compose.yml
|
||||
docker compose up -d
|
||||
```
